Police investigating home invasion

Police are asking the public’s help in finding two masked men who broke into a home in St. John’s with guns and demanded money from the residents.

It happened on Monday at 11:30 p.m.

RNC patrol services, major crime unit, police dog services and forensic identification services responded to a report of “unknown trouble” at a house on Castle Bride Drive.

One of the residents sustained minor injuries during an altercation with one of the assailants.

The suspects had left the area before police were called.

One of the men was described as being 6-2 in height, slim and in his early 30s.

The second man is about 5-8 with a slim build and a pale complexion with red hair and facial hair.

Both were said to have been wearing blue jeans, dark coats and hoods and/or masks.

Anyone who has information that would assist in identifying the individuals responsible or anyone who may have any information in relation to this crime is asked to contact the RNC at 729-8000 or Crime Stoppers at 1-800-222-TIPS (8477). Information can also be provided anonymously on the NL Crime Stoppers Website at www.nlcrimestoppers.com.
